yank: yank (yank terminal output to clipboard) yank: yank: The yank(1) utility reads input from stdin and display a selection yank: interface that allows a field to be selected and copied to the yank: clipboard. Fields are either recognized by a regular expression using yank: the -g option or by splitting the input on a delimiter sequence using yank: the -d option. yank: yank: Using the arrow keys will move the selected field. The interface yank: supports several Emacs and Vi like key bindings, consult the man page yank: for further reference.
